Getting Started
Step 1: Preparation
Check the supplied accessories
When you have taken everything out of the carton, check that you have these items: � Remote control � Two R6 (size AA) batteries � Stabilizer band � Two clamps � Two wood screws � These operating instructions
Step 2: Installing the video TV
Secure the video TV
To prevent the video TV from falling, secure it using one of the following methods:
Getting Started
A With the supplied screws, attach the stabilizer band to the TV stand and to
the rear of the video TV using the existing hole.
OR
B Pass a cord or chain through the clamps and secure them to the rear of the
video TV and a wall or pillar.
Insert the batteries into the remote control
Note � Do not use old batteries or different types of batteries together.
